- Brief Summary
This project aims to identify the effect of a 3-week Grand Tour (e.g. Tour de France, Giro d'Italia, and Vuelta a España) on sleep, hematological parameters and the serum metabolome in world-class cyclists.

- Arm && Interventions
Group Intervention Description Elite cyclists participating in a Grand Tour Cyclist * Sleep metrics will be tracked by a smart ring (OURA Gen3, OURA Health Ltd, Oulu, Finland) starting from one month prior to the start till the end of the Grand Tour * Nocturnal heart rate and heart rate variability will be collected by a smart ring (OURA Gen3, OURA Health Ltd, Oulu, Finland) starting from one month prior till the end of the Grand Tour * Fasted whole blood samples and urine samples will be collected on the morning of (i) the first stage, (ii) the first restday, (iii) second restday, and (iv) last stage of the GrandTour (only in one Grand Tour for a total of 8 cyclists).
- Primary Outcome Measures
Name Time Method Sleep efficiency during the Grand Tour Every night starting from one week before till the last night of the Grand Tour Percentage change in sleep efficiency during the Grand Tour (measured by OURA ring)
Total sleep time during the Grand Tour Every night starting from one week before till the last night of the Grand Tour Change in total sleep time during the Grand Tour (measured by OURA ring)
Blood haemoglobin concentration Start of the Grand Tour - restday 1 of the Grand Tour - restday 2 of the Grand Tour - last day of the Grand Tour Change in the blood haemoglobin concentration during the Grand Tour
Serum metabolome abundance of cyclists participating in a Grand Tour Start of the Grand Tour - restday 1 of the Grand Tour - restday 2 of the Grand Tour - last day of the Grand Tour Changes in the abundance of serum metabolites within the cyclists between 4 timepoints (measured by mass spectrometry)
